This 159.1 acre property in Holmes County is the perfect tract for an investor or outdoorsman. This property is primarily made up of 2-year-old planted pines with some timber still standing along the creeks. An established road system throughout the property allows easy access to the entire tract and there were tons of wildlife sign throughout the property. There are also utilities available on the road. This property is at a stage to make it your own and bring your vision to life! Additional acreage is available.
